MOVE Token Launch Ends in Disaster as Deceptive Deal Leads to Price Collapse
2025/04/30 21:44
A massive crypto scandal has unfolded, with the launch of MOVE turning into a complete disaster, causing its price to plummet to an all-time low of $0.219.
Initially poised for success, MOVE was expected to hit new highs. However, a financial deal that was supposed to boost the token’s success instead led to market manipulation and shady tactics, causing its price to collapse.
Deceptive Deal Leads to a Price Collapse
The Movement Foundation, behind the launch of MOVE, is now under investigation for signing a deal that gave a single entity disproportionate control over the token market. The agreement granted Web3Port, a Chinese market maker with ties to Donald Trump-affiliated World Liberty Financial, significant leverage.
This resulted in the sale of 66 million MOVE tokens just one day after their debut in December. The massive token dump triggered a sharp price drop and sparked allegations of insider trading.
Rentech: The Middleman at the Center of the Scandal
Internal messages from Movement’s co-founder, Cooper Scanlon, revealed that they were deceived into working with a middleman named Rentech. Initially believed to be a subsidiary of Web3Port, Rentech turned out to be a separate entity that facilitated this market manipulation.
The deal allowed Rentech to borrow up to 5% of MOVE’s total supply, giving them significant control over the token’s price, raising red flags about potential price manipulation.
The market-making agreements involved unusual provisions, such as one that incentivized Rentech to artificially push the price of MOVE token over $5 billion in value. This setup would have allowed them to profit from a sharp price rise and then sell off their tokens, benefiting from the inflated price.
Industry experts, including crypto founder Zaki Manian, called this structure “dangerous” and unethical, accusing the deal of encouraging price manipulation.
Internal Conflicts and Investigation
Movement is also facing internal tensions. Allegations have surfaced about co-founder Rushi Manche’s involvement in pushing for the deal, with some suggesting that conflicts of interest played a role.
The company is now investigating these claims and working to hold those responsible accountable.
Binance Steps In
As a result of the token dump, Binance, one of the largest crypto exchanges, banned the market-making account tied to Rentech. In response, Movement Foundation launched a token buyback initiative to stabilize the price and regain investor trust.
Despite the negative press and the fallout from the price crash, Movement Labs has promised to investigate the circumstances surrounding the deal and ensure accountability.
